Indiana congressman, 17 colleagues, nominate Trump for Nobel Peace Prize

Six of the members that signed the letter are running for higher office in 2018.

According to the guidelines from the Norwegian Nobel Committee, Members of Congress qualify as nominators for Nobel Peace Prizes.

Messer's campaign has referred one of his opponents, Rep. Todd Rokita, as "Lying Todd Rokita," while businessman Mike Braun is running an ad featuring cardboard cutouts of his two opponents asking people on the street to try and tell Messer and Rokita apart.

Rokita is not one of the House members who signed onto Messer's letter nominating Trump for a Nobel Prize.

President Trump told reporters in the Oval Office Tuesday that the exact date and location of his meeting with North Korean leader Kim Jong Un will be announced in the next "couple of days."

"We're setting up meetings right now and I think it's probably going to be announced over the next couple of days – location and date," Trump said.

Denuclearization of North Korea has been a key issue going into the talks between the U.S. and North Korea. The North is suspending, not freezing, its nuclear tests for now, but both Trump and South Korean President Moon Jae-in have expressed hopes that the North is ready to give up its nuclear weapons in exchange for economic assistance.
